These guys are usually considered only minor pests when in their larval form (caterpillar) - especially in plant nurseries. It's reported that they rarely do any serious damage tho' .. Ailanthus Webworm Moth (Atteva punctella) > http://davesgarden.com/bf/go/908/
We have a tendency to forget that these guys serve as valuable pollinators also - while in their moth form!
It's nice when folks are willing to allow the moths to nectar upon the flowers (which is generally what they're doing this time of year, in the south).
